Como instalar Ultrastar (clon de SingStar) en la raspberry pi

Sección Unicamente para Tutoriales y Guías
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

vale me autorrespondo la imagen es para la 3 no para la 3b+, supongo que me toca hacerlo a mano intentando seguir los comandos que hay al principio del hilo.
La duda es, CapNida, ( o cualquier otr@) que imagen me recomiendas instalarme para empezar a hacer una instalación desde cero, una raspbian? alguna otra??

Gracias
Frankiii
Pi Alpha
Pi Alpha
Mensajes: 29
Registrado: 20 Ago 2017, 09:28
Agradecido: 0
Agradecimiento recibido: 0

Debiera de funcionar igual compañero. Lo que puede variar es si es otra versión de raspbian

Enviado desde mi SM-G950F mediante Tapatalk

Avatar de Usuario
Anubis_13
Pi Omega
Pi Omega
Mensajes: 46
Registrado: 02 Ene 2018, 13:01
Agradecido: 0
Agradecimiento recibido: 0

javichoraspberry escribió: 15 Feb 2019, 12:09 vale me autorrespondo la imagen es para la 3 no para la 3b+, supongo que me toca hacerlo a mano intentando seguir los comandos que hay al principio del hilo.
La duda es, CapNida, ( o cualquier otr@) que imagen me recomiendas instalarme para empezar a hacer una instalación desde cero, una raspbian? alguna otra??

Gracias
SI creas la imagen para la b+ la vas a compartir?
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

Si lo consigo no tendría inconveniente en hacerlo Anubis.
De raspberry estoy muy muy verde, pero confío en que sabiendo bastante de linux pueda apañarme con el script para la 3.
Avatar de Usuario
Anubis_13
Pi Omega
Pi Omega
Mensajes: 46
Registrado: 02 Ene 2018, 13:01
Agradecido: 0
Agradecimiento recibido: 0

javichoraspberry escribió: 22 Feb 2019, 12:47 Si lo consigo no tendría inconveniente en hacerlo Anubis.
De raspberry estoy muy muy verde, pero confío en que sabiendo bastante de linux pueda apañarme con el script para la 3.
Pues dale ahi que seguro lo sacas yo de linux 0 patatero
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

Bueno pues ya lo medio tengo corriendo en raspberry 3b+.
El script de @Frankii

Antes de hacer una imagen quiero intentar ver qué cosas rarar me hace con el HDMI. Creo que es culpa de mi monitor porque si saco el HDMI y lo convierto a VGA el monitor lo ve pero la entrada HDMI no, sin embargo en la TV va bien pero no tenía sonido.

Tambien quiero ver si saco tiempo para que tocando el udev me monte un disco usb en una ruta siempre y asi dejar las canciones en un pen drive.

La imagen se hace con el win32diskimager?
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

Leyendo acerca de esto, tengo bastantes videos viejos (tipo rocio jurado) que se ven bien en ultrastar pc pero borrosos en raspberry he pensado que tengo que bajarlos la resolucion, no se si os ocurre tambien porque lo que veo que le pasa a la gente es al reves, videos modernos que tienen demasiada calidad para ir fluidos.

El caso es que leyendo este hilo se me ocurre 2 opciones para no procesar esos videos SD.
Te haces un script que con ffprobe o ffmpeg -i te saque la resolucion del video y luego si tienen menos de X, creas esa entrada en el .procesado, o lo integras en el bucle de Capniida como comprobacion previa.

para sacarlo la resolcuion se puede hacer algo asi ( no tengo delante un video)
ffmpeg -i parte2.mp4 2>&1 | grep Stream | grep Video | cut -d "," -f3


CapNida escribió: 01 Feb 2019, 10:57
Frankiii escribió: 29 Ene 2019, 21:16
CapNida escribió: 11 Dic 2018, 14:10

Hola @skiso

Para poder utilizar el script de comprimir vídeos tienes que recompilar el ffmepg.
En el script de instalación que estés usando (el mio o el de @Frankiii) busca la siguiente linea de compilación del ffmpeg:

Código: Seleccionar todo

./configure --enable-shared --enable-pic --disable-static --prefix=/usr --arch=armel --enable-pthreads --enable-runtime-cpudetect --enable-neon --enable-bzlib --enable-libfreetype --enable-gpl --shlibdir=/usr/lib/arm-linux-gnueabihf/neon/vfp --cpu=armv7-a --extra-cflags='-mfpu=neon -fPIC -DPIC' --enable-libx264 --enable-mmal --enable-hwaccel=h264_mmal --enable-omx-rpi --enable-omx --enable-opengl --enable-nonfree --enable-libtheora --enable-decoder=h264_mmal --enable-decoder=mpeg2_mmal --enable-decoder=mpeg4_mmal --enable-encoder=h264_omx --enable-encoder=h264_omx --enable-avresample --enable-libass --enable-libmp3lame --enable-libvorbis --enable-libvpx --enable-libopus --disable-decoder=h264 --disable-decoder=mpeg4 --disable-encoder=libx264 --disable-encoder=mpeg4
Atención porque puede haber varias. La linea que tienes que modificar es la que NO comienza por #. (Es la linea 122 en mi script y 131 en el script de @Frankiii)
En esa linea, si te fijas la última opción, pone --disable-encoder=mpeg4 .
Debes cambiar eso por --enable-encoder=mpeg4 .
La linea debe quedar así:

Código: Seleccionar todo

./configure --enable-shared --enable-pic --disable-static --prefix=/usr --arch=armel --enable-pthreads --enable-runtime-cpudetect --enable-neon --enable-bzlib --enable-libfreetype --enable-gpl --shlibdir=/usr/lib/arm-linux-gnueabihf/neon/vfp --cpu=armv7-a --extra-cflags='-mfpu=neon -fPIC -DPIC' --enable-libx264 --enable-mmal --enable-hwaccel=h264_mmal --enable-omx-rpi --enable-omx --enable-opengl --enable-nonfree --enable-libtheora --enable-decoder=h264_mmal --enable-decoder=mpeg2_mmal --enable-decoder=mpeg4_mmal --enable-encoder=h264_omx --enable-encoder=h264_omx --enable-avresample --enable-libass --enable-libmp3lame --enable-libvorbis --enable-libvpx --enable-libopus --disable-decoder=h264 --disable-decoder=mpeg4 --disable-encoder=libx264 --enable-encoder=mpeg4
Una vez hecho el cambio, vuelve a ejecutar el script y recompila el ffmpeg.
Saludos.
CapNida este script es genial. :mrgreen:

Habría alguna posibilidad de que no recodificara los videos que tienen una resolución inferior a la indicada en el script?. Tengo muchas canciones antiguas en resolución sd que no es necesario recodificar y me ahorro tiempo.

:avergonzado
Si no quieres que procese algunas carpetas puedes crear el archivo oculto ".procesado" en las carpetas donde estén los vídeos en resolución SD.
Para que detecte la resolución del video y si es menor que la definida en RESOLUCION no recodifique, habría que rehacer el script y ahora no tengo tiempo, lo siento.
Frankiii
Pi Alpha
Pi Alpha
Mensajes: 29
Registrado: 20 Ago 2017, 09:28
Agradecido: 0
Agradecimiento recibido: 0

javichoraspberry escribió:Leyendo acerca de esto, tengo bastantes videos viejos (tipo rocio jurado) que se ven bien en ultrastar pc pero borrosos en raspberry he pensado que tengo que bajarlos la resolucion, no se si os ocurre tambien porque lo que veo que le pasa a la gente es al reves, videos modernos que tienen demasiada calidad para ir fluidos.

El caso es que leyendo este hilo se me ocurre 2 opciones para no procesar esos videos SD.
Te haces un script que con ffprobe o ffmpeg -i te saque la resolucion del video y luego si tienen menos de X, creas esa entrada en el .procesado, o lo integras en el bucle de Capniida como comprobacion previa.

para sacarlo la resolcuion se puede hacer algo asi ( no tengo delante un video)
ffmpeg -i parte2.mp4 2>&1 | grep Stream | grep Video | cut -d "," -f3


CapNida escribió: 01 Feb 2019, 10:57
Frankiii escribió: 29 Ene 2019, 21:16 CapNida este script es genial. :mrgreen:

Habría alguna posibilidad de que no recodificara los videos que tienen una resolución inferior a la indicada en el script?. Tengo muchas canciones antiguas en resolución sd que no es necesario recodificar y me ahorro tiempo.

:avergonzado
Si no quieres que procese algunas carpetas puedes crear el archivo oculto ".procesado" en las carpetas donde estén los vídeos en resolución SD.
Para que detecte la resolución del video y si es menor que la definida en RESOLUCION no recodifique, habría que rehacer el script y ahora no tengo tiempo, lo siento.
En ello estoy compañero, pero me está costando dominar ffmpeg aunque en la versión Windows lo tengo a piñón jejjee

Si lo consigo lo posteo aquí

Enviado desde mi SM-G950F mediante Tapatalk

jav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

Creo que me estaba liando con las resoluciones, los videos con ffplay a tamaño de ventana consola se ven bien, pero al aumentarlos a pantalla completa se ven bastante mal, os pasa igual? Claro reduciéndolo de calidad no van a mejorar y aumentandolo tampoco porque simplemente interpolaría.

He creado una imagen @Anubis_13 pero me queda aun comprimida mas de 10 Gb. Si consigo una sd de 8gb decente podria hacer otra, porque subir esa sin fibra optica me es imposible.

De todas maneras es muy muy sencillo con una imagen para las raspberry pi 3b+ . en mi caso la Raspbian Stretch with desktop y la maravillo sa guia de @CapNida y el script de @Frankiii todo me ha ido a la primera (o casi).

Si te animas a intentarlo te puedo ayudar si te tascas en algún lado, es ir haciendo copia pega de los comandos que ponen
Avatar de Usuario
Anubis_13
Pi Omega
Pi Omega
Mensajes: 46
Registrado: 02 Ene 2018, 13:01
Agradecido: 0
Agradecimiento recibido: 0

javichoraspberry escribió: 26 Feb 2019, 20:28 Creo que me estaba liando con las resoluciones, los videos con ffplay a tamaño de ventana consola se ven bien, pero al aumentarlos a pantalla completa se ven bastante mal, os pasa igual? Claro reduciéndolo de calidad no van a mejorar y aumentandolo tampoco porque simplemente interpolaría.

He creado una imagen @Anubis_13 pero me queda aun comprimida mas de 10 Gb. Si consigo una sd de 8gb decente podria hacer otra, porque subir esa sin fibra optica me es imposible.

De todas maneras es muy muy sencillo con una imagen para las raspberry pi 3b+ . en mi caso la Raspbian Stretch with desktop y la maravillo sa guia de @CapNida y el script de @Frankiii todo me ha ido a la primera (o casi).

Si te animas a intentarlo te puedo ayudar si te tascas en algún lado, es ir haciendo copia pega de los comandos que ponen
No se como decirlo soy un negao, estoy liao intentando meter juegos en batocera y no hay cojones, ya crear una imagen seguro me corto las venas jejejej no te preocupes entiendo que no puedas subirlo,si lo haces estare agradecido y alguno mas seguro :)
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

Anubis_13 escribió:
javichoraspberry escribió: 26 Feb 2019, 20:28 Creo que me estaba liando con las resoluciones, los videos con ffplay a tamaño de ventana consola se ven bien, pero al aumentarlos a pantalla completa se ven bastante mal, os pasa igual? Claro reduciéndolo de calidad no van a mejorar y aumentandolo tampoco porque simplemente interpolaría.

He creado una imagen @Anubis_13 pero me queda aun comprimida mas de 10 Gb. Si consigo una sd de 8gb decente podria hacer otra, porque subir esa sin fibra optica me es imposible.

De todas maneras es muy muy sencillo con una imagen para las raspberry pi 3b+ . en mi caso la Raspbian Stretch with desktop y la maravillo sa guia de @CapNida y el script de @Frankiii todo me ha ido a la primera (o casi).

Si te animas a intentarlo te puedo ayudar si te tascas en algún lado, es ir haciendo copia pega de los comandos que ponen
No se como decirlo soy un negao, estoy liao intentando meter juegos en batocera y no hay cojones, ya crear una imagen seguro me corto las venas jejejej no te preocupes entiendo que no puedas subirlo,si lo haces estare agradecido y alguno mas seguro :)
Estoy en tramites para tener fibra optica, en cuanto me la pongan subo una :D
Avatar de Usuario
Anubis_13
Pi Omega
Pi Omega
Mensajes: 46
Registrado: 02 Ene 2018, 13:01
Agradecido: 0
Agradecimiento recibido: 0

perfecto que buena noticia gracias
skippper
Pi Alpha
Pi Alpha
Mensajes: 26
Registrado: 16 May 2016, 17:49
Agradecido: 0
Agradecimiento recibido: 0

Tenéis la imagen esa q íbais a crear actualizada? Muchísimas graciasa
Avatar de Usuario
Anubis_13
Pi Omega
Pi Omega
Mensajes: 46
Registrado: 02 Ene 2018, 13:01
Agradecido: 0
Agradecimiento recibido: 0

Si lees arriba la imagen es de javichoraspberry y hasta que no tenga fibra no l a va a poder subir.Solo es cuestion de tiempo asi que toca esperar jejeje ;)
skippper
Pi Alpha
Pi Alpha
Mensajes: 26
Registrado: 16 May 2016, 17:49
Agradecido: 0
Agradecimiento recibido: 0

Si si, es que me emocioné desde el movil leyendo :) a ver si le ponen a javichoraspberry la fibra :)

Gracias
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

Buenas, ya tengo fibra, he pasado el dia intentando instalar de cero todo en una sd de 8 Gb, pero algo se me ha pasado y se me mueven un poco las letras en los menus del ultrastar, y el fondo cuando de selecciona la opcion.
A las malas si no doy con ello esta semana subo la imagen que guarde de 32 Gb.
Avatar de Usuario
Anubis_13
Pi Omega
Pi Omega
Mensajes: 46
Registrado: 02 Ene 2018, 13:01
Agradecido: 0
Agradecimiento recibido: 0

javichoraspberry escribió: 18 Mar 2019, 00:46 Buenas, ya tengo fibra, he pasado el dia intentando instalar de cero todo en una sd de 8 Gb, pero algo se me ha pasado y se me mueven un poco las letras en los menus del ultrastar, y el fondo cuando de selecciona la opcion.
A las malas si no doy con ello esta semana subo la imagen que guarde de 32 Gb.

que buena noticia sobreo todo para ti que tengas fibra. :mrgreen:

No entiendo es de seleccion en el menú.Te refieres a si cambias el fondo o algo se te mueven las letras :duda
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

En el menú de ultrastrat Las letras se me bailan un poco y al seleccionar una opción el cambio del color del fondo me aparece por encima o por debajo en lugar de sobre la opcion. Voy a hacer una instalacion limpia de nuevo, porque creo que alguna opcion de las de instalacion no las hice igual que la primera vez.
javichoraspberry
Pi Alpha
Pi Alpha
Mensajes: 14
Registrado: 14 Feb 2019, 13:49
Agradecido: 0
Agradecimiento recibido: 0

@Anubis_13 @skippper

He creado (espero que bien) una imagen para SD 8Gb, solo está instalado el ultrastar original (el otro que puso Frankii de momento no me funciona). Me he vuelto loco porque hago lo mismo para la version de 32 pero los menus no se ven del todo bien, pero es totalmente jugable.
Como lei que el link a la NAS daba problemas a la gente no lo he creado.
Si quereis instalarla y probar, mientras voy a seguir intentando afinar cosas a ver si consigo que quede igual que la version de 32 Gb, posiblemente haya algo nuevo en el Sw base de las raspberry respecto a la version de 32 y por eso no se comporta igual.
De todas maneras no ha sido tan dramatico subir esto asi que prepararé una version de 32 Gb tambien pronto para subirla. Por cierto @Anubis_13 me surge la duda, como quitas tu wifi o tu configuracion personal para crear una imagen y subirla? Yo he modificado directamente el wpa_suplicant pero no se si es la opcion mas limpia.

https://drive.google.com/file/d/1qmLj_V ... j79lW/view
Frankiii
Pi Alpha
Pi Alpha
Mensajes: 29
Registrado: 20 Ago 2017, 09:28
Agradecido: 0
Agradecimiento recibido: 0

El ultra star world party no funciona xq han actualizado la versión y un archivo falla, y por cierto a mi me funciona con las canciones en el nas jejeje

Instalarlo en fácil, solo tienes que seguir un orden en los pasos y esperar los 20 minutos que tarda en hacerse.


Enviado desde mi SM-G950F mediante Tapatalk

Responder